Aberglasney Gardens, Carmarthenshire

In their spectacular setting in the Tywi Valley of Carmarthenshire in Wales, these beautiful gardens exude a sense of romance. Even in February you will be entranced by the beautifully restored buildings, including the formal Cloister Garden, enclosed by a broad parapet walkway on three sides, and the extraordinary Ninfarium, which has been created from the ruined central rooms and courtyard of the mansion. The surviving walls of the rooms have been stabilised and the entire area is covered with a huge glass atrium and now contains a wonderful collection of warm temperate and sub-tropical plants including orchids, palms, magnolias and cycads.
